What is a Private Psychiatrist Assessment?

A private psychiatrist assessment is an in-depth evaluation conducted by a psychiatrist in a private practice setting. The main goal is to detect mental health conditions and develop suitable treatment strategies tailored to an individual's particular requirements. These assessments typically include an extensive evaluation of an individual's psychological history, symptoms, and other pertinent aspects.

Purpose of a Private Psychiatrist Assessment

  • Accurate Diagnosis: To accurately detect mental health conditions.
  • Customized Treatment Plans: To develop customized treatment plans based on the individual's needs.
  • Monitoring Progress: To track development and make changes to treatment techniques.
  • Safe Environment: To offer a personal and safe space for going over personal problems.

The Assessment Process

The assessment process generally unfolds over numerous stages, guaranteeing a detailed evaluation of the person's mental health.

Step 1: Initial Consultation

The initial step involves a preliminary assessment, where the psychiatrist gathers relevant details regarding the individual's mental health history, personal background, and present signs.

Step 2: Detailed Assessment

Throughout this phase, the psychiatrist conducts an extensive evaluation. This may include:

  • Clinical Interviews: Engaging in conversations to understand the patient's mental health history.
  • Psychometric Tests: Utilizing standardized questionnaires and assessments.
  • Household History Review: Looking into any familial patterns of mental health issues.

Step 3: Diagnosis and Treatment Plan

Following the assessment, the psychiatrist will provide a diagnosis (if appropriate) and go over possible treatment options. This customized treatment plan may consist of treatment, medication, way of life modifications, or recommendations to other professionals.

Step 4: Follow-Up Sessions

Regular follow-up sessions might be set up to keep an eye on the individual's progress, evaluate the effectiveness of the treatment plan, and make required modifications.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How much does a private psychiatrist assessment cost?

Costs can differ widely based on the psychiatrist's experience and location. Sessions normally range from ₤ 150 to ₤ 500.

2. The length of time does an assessment take?

The majority of assessments last in between 60 to 90 minutes, but some may take longer based upon private needs.

3. Will my insurance coverage cover private assessments?

Protection depends on the specific insurance coverage strategy. It's a good idea to talk to the insurance service provider in advance.

4. Do I need a recommendation to see a private psychiatrist?

No recommendation is generally necessary to see a private psychiatrist, but it might depend on your insurance policy.

5. What should I prepare for the assessment?

It's beneficial to prepare a summary of your mental health history, existing medications, and a list of signs or challenges you're dealing with.
